SEARCH

idear下载IntelliJ IDEA 最新版本获取、安装与配置全攻略

引言:为何“idear下载”成为您的搜索焦点?

在当今高速发展的软件开发领域,一款高效、智能的集成开发环境(IDE)无疑是程序员提升生产力的关键工具。当您搜索“idear下载”时,我们深知您正在寻找的是业界顶尖的Java和Kotlin开发利器——IntelliJ IDEA。尽管“idear”可能是对“IDEA”的一种常见误读或习惯性称呼,但这并不影响我们为您提供最精准、最权威的下载与安装指南。本文将围绕“idear下载”这一核心关键词,为您详细解析IntelliJ IDEA的获取、安装、配置及其常见问题,助您顺利开启或提升您的编程之旅。

“idear”究竟为何物?为何备受推崇?

“idear”所指的,正是由JetBrains公司开发的IntelliJ IDEA。它被广泛认为是目前市场上功能最强大、最智能的Java集成开发环境之一,同时对Kotlin、Groovy、Scala等JVM语言及前端技术(如JavaScript、TypeScript、React、Angular等)也提供了卓越的支持。其备受推崇的原因主要包括:

  • 智能代码辅助: 提供深度代码分析、智能补全、重构工具、错误检测等,显著提升编码效率。
  • 强大的调试器: 高效的调试工具,帮助开发者快速定位并修复bug。
  • 版本控制集成: 无缝集成Git、SVN等主流版本控制系统。
  • 丰富的插件生态: 拥有庞大的插件市场,可根据需求扩展功能,支持各种框架和技术。
  • 用户友好的界面: 直观的操作界面和高度可定制性,满足不同开发者的习惯。
  • 卓越的性能: 在大型项目处理和性能优化方面表现出色。

官方“idear下载”途径:安全与可靠的首选

获取任何软件,尤其是开发工具,首要原则是选择官方、安全、可靠的下载渠道。对于“idear下载”而言,这意味着您必须通过JetBrains公司的官方网站进行下载,以避免潜在的病毒、恶意软件或不完整的安装包。

官方下载地址:认准JetBrains官网

要进行安全、可靠的“idear下载”,请务必访问JetBrains的官方网站:https://www.jetbrains.com/idea/download/

在此页面,您将找到IntelliJ IDEA的最新版本,以及不同操作系统的下载选项。强烈建议您从官方渠道下载,这不仅能保证您获得的是正版、无毒的软件,还能确保享受到最新的功能更新和安全补丁。

选择合适的“idear”版本:Community vs. Ultimate

在进行“idear下载”时,您会发现IntelliJ IDEA提供了两个主要版本:

  1. IntelliJ IDEA Community Edition(社区版):
    • 特点: 免费开源,功能强大,足以满足绝大多数Java、Kotlin、Android应用及Maven/Gradle项目的开发需求。它提供了核心的JVM语言开发工具和集成。
    • 适用人群: 学生、个人开发者、小型团队、开源项目贡献者,以及主要进行Java/Kotlin后端开发的程序员。
    • 下载提示: 社区版是完全免费的,您可以永久使用。
  2. IntelliJ IDEA Ultimate Edition(旗舰版):
    • 特点: 付费商业版本,功能极其全面,除了社区版的所有功能外,还提供了对企业级技术(如Spring、Java EE、各种数据库工具)、前端框架(如AngularJS、React、Vue.js)、Web服务器、版本控制高级功能等的深度支持。
    • 适用人群: 专业开发者、大型企业团队、需要全栈开发支持、或使用多种企业级框架和技术的开发者。
    • 下载提示: 旗舰版提供30天免费试用期。学生和教师可以通过教育授权免费使用。

在决定进行哪种“idear下载”之前,请根据您的具体需求和预算,仔细权衡这两个版本的特性。

“idear下载”步骤详解:手把手教您获取

明确了版本选择后,接下来我们将详细指导您如何从官方网站完成“idear下载”的过程。

第一步:访问JetBrains官网IntelliJ IDEA下载页面

打开您的网络浏览器,输入或点击链接:https://www.jetbrains.com/idea/download/

第二步:定位IntelliJ IDEA下载页面

进入页面后,您会看到页面中央显著位置显示着IntelliJ IDEA的最新版本信息,以及针对不同操作系统的下载选项卡(Windows、macOS、Linux)。

第三步:选择操作系统与版本

根据您的计算机操作系统,点击对应的选项卡:

  • Windows用户: 通常会提供.exe安装包下载。
  • macOS用户: 通常提供.dmg磁盘镜像文件下载。
  • Linux用户: 通常提供.tar.gz归档文件下载。

在每个操作系统选项卡下方,您还会看到“Ultimate”和“Community”两个按钮。请根据您之前选择的版本,点击相应的下载按钮。

下载提示: 在点击下载按钮之前,请留意下载按钮下方或页面顶部是否提供了该版本安装包的MD5或SHA-256校验值。下载完成后,您可以使用校验工具核对文件哈希值,确保下载文件的完整性和未被篡改。

第四步:开始下载“idear”安装包

点击下载按钮后,您的浏览器会开始下载IntelliJ IDEA的安装包。下载时间取决于您的网络速度和文件大小(通常为数百MB)。请耐心等待下载完成。

下载过程中,您可以观察浏览器的下载进度。建议在网络状况良好的环境下进行“idear下载”,以避免下载中断或文件损坏。

“idear”安装指南:下载后的必经之路

成功完成“idear下载”后,下一步就是将其安装到您的计算机上。不同操作系统的安装过程略有差异。

Windows系统安装

  1. 运行安装程序: 找到下载好的.exe文件(例如:ideaIC-202X.X.X.exe,其中“IC”代表Community版,如果是Ultimate版则没有“IC”),双击运行。
  2. 用户账户控制: 如果出现“用户账户控制”提示,点击“是”允许程序运行。
  3. 安装向导: 遵循安装向导的指示。
    • 欢迎界面: 点击“Next”。
    • 选择安装路径: 建议保持默认路径,或选择一个您熟悉的磁盘空间充足的路径。点击“Next”。
    • 安装选项:
      • Create Desktop Shortcut: 建议勾选,方便桌面启动。
      • Create Associations: 建议勾选.java.kt等文件类型,以便双击文件时能用IDEA打开。
      • Download and Install JBR: 强烈建议勾选,IDEA会自带一个优化过的Java运行时(JDK),避免您手动配置。
      • Add launchers dir to the PATH: 勾选后可以在命令行直接启动IDEA,方便高级用户。
      点击“Next”。
    • 选择开始菜单文件夹: 保持默认即可,点击“Install”。
    • 安装过程: 等待安装完成。
    • 完成安装: 勾选“Run IntelliJ IDEA”或点击“Finish”完成安装。

macOS系统安装

  1. 打开DMG文件: 找到下载好的.dmg文件(例如:ideaIC-202X.X.dmg),双击打开。
  2. 拖拽应用程序: 在弹出的窗口中,将IntelliJ IDEA图标拖拽到“Applications”文件夹中。
  3. 关闭DMG: 拖拽完成后,关闭DMG窗口并将其弹出(右键DMG文件图标选择“推出”或拖拽到废纸篓)。
  4. 首次启动:
    • 打开“Applications”文件夹,找到IntelliJ IDEA图标,双击启动。
    • 首次启动可能会提示“此应用来自互联网,是否确定打开?”,点击“打开”。
    • 如果您的系统偏好设置中阻止了来自“未知开发者”的应用,您可能需要在“系统偏好设置”>“安全性与隐私”中,点击“仍要打开”来允许其运行。

Linux系统安装(以.tar.gz包为例)

  1. 解压文件: 将下载的.tar.gz文件移动到您希望安装的目录(例如:/opt/~/Downloads)。
    打开终端,进入该目录,并执行解压命令:
    tar -xzf ideaIC-202X.X.tar.gz (替换为您的实际文件名)
  2. 进入bin目录: 解压后会生成一个类似idea-IC-202X.X的文件夹,进入其下的bin目录:
    cd idea-IC-202X.X/bin
  3. 运行安装脚本: 执行启动脚本:
    ./idea.sh
  4. 首次启动配置: 首次启动会引导您进行初始配置,例如接受用户协议、导入设置等。
  5. 创建桌面快捷方式(可选): 在IDEA启动后,可以通过菜单栏Tools -> Create Desktop Entry来创建桌面快捷方式或添加到应用程序启动器。

安装前的系统要求与注意事项

在进行“idear下载”和安装之前,请确保您的系统满足以下基本要求:

  • 操作系统: Windows 10/11 (64位), macOS 10.15+, Linux (基于Gnome或KDE桌面环境)。
  • 内存(RAM): 推荐8 GB RAM,最低4 GB RAM。处理大型项目或同时运行多个内存密集型应用时,16 GB或更多会提供更流畅的体验。
  • 磁盘空间: 至少3.5 GB硬盘空间,推荐使用SSD固态硬盘以获得最佳性能。
  • 屏幕分辨率: 1024x768以上。
  • JDK: 虽然IntelliJ IDEA通常自带JBR(JetBrains Runtime),但如果您要开发特定版本的Java项目,可能需要单独安装和配置对应的JDK。

确保您的系统符合这些要求,能够最大化“idear下载”并成功安装后的使用体验。

首次启动与基础配置:让您的“idear”更顺手

成功安装并首次启动IntelliJ IDEA后,您会遇到一些初始配置步骤,这些步骤将帮助您根据个人喜好和开发需求进行个性化设置。

导入设置与主题选择

首次启动时,IDEA会询问您是否要导入之前的设置(如果您之前安装过)或选择一个主题(如深色主题Darcula或浅色主题Light)。您可以根据喜好选择,后续也可以在“File”->“Settings/Preferences”中更改。

插件市场与功能拓展

IntelliJ IDEA的强大之处在于其丰富的插件生态系统。您可以通过以下步骤浏览和安装插件:

  1. 在欢迎界面或启动后,点击“Plugins”(插件)选项。
  2. 在弹出的插件市场中,您可以搜索并安装各种插件,例如:
    • Lombok Plugin: 为使用Lombok框架的项目提供支持。
    • MyBatisX: 简化MyBatis开发。
    • Chinese (Simplified) Language Pack / 中文语言包: 将IDE界面汉化。
    • GitToolBox: 增强Git功能显示。
  3. 安装后通常需要重启IDEA才能生效。

JDK配置与项目创建

虽然IDEA通常自带JBR,但为了进行Java项目开发,您可能需要配置或关联外部安装的JDK。这通常在创建新项目时或在“File”->“Project Structure”(项目结构)中完成。确保您选择的JDK版本与您的项目兼容。

配置完成后,您就可以通过“New Project”来创建您的第一个Java、Kotlin或Spring Boot项目了。

“idear下载”常见问题与故障排除

在“idear下载”和安装过程中,用户可能会遇到一些常见问题。以下是一些常见场景及其解决方案:

下载速度慢怎么办?

  • 更换网络环境: 尝试切换到更稳定的Wi-Fi或有线网络。
  • 使用下载管理器: 专业的下载管理器(如IDM、Free Download Manager)可以多线程下载,提高速度并支持断点续传。
  • 避开高峰期: 尝试在非网络使用高峰时段进行下载。
  • 检查带宽: 确保您的网络带宽足够。

安装失败或报错?

  • 检查系统要求: 确认您的操作系统版本、内存、磁盘空间等是否满足IntelliJ IDEA的最低要求。
  • 管理员权限: 在Windows上,尝试右键安装程序,选择“以管理员身份运行”。
  • 安全软件干扰: 暂时关闭防病毒软件或防火墙,待安装完成后再开启。有些安全软件可能会误报或阻止安装。
  • 下载文件损坏: 重新下载安装包,并核对其MD5/SHA-256校验值,确保文件完整。
  • 磁盘空间不足: 清理磁盘空间,确保安装路径有足够的剩余空间。

无法启动IntelliJ IDEA?

  • 检查日志文件: IDEA通常会在用户目录下的一个隐藏文件夹中生成日志文件(例如:Windows在C:Users.IntelliJIdeasystemlog,macOS在~/Library/Logs/JetBrains/IntelliJIdea)。查看日志文件通常能找到具体的错误信息。
  • 内存不足: 如果系统内存不足或IDEA配置的JVM内存过小,可能导致启动失败。尝试修改.vmoptions文件来调整JVM内存参数。
  • Java环境问题: 确保您的Java环境(JDK)配置正确,或者您允许IDEA下载并安装了JBR。
  • 清理缓存: 尝试删除IDEA的系统缓存目录(在上述日志文件所在的父目录,通常是system文件夹)。
  • 重新安装: 如果以上方法无效,尝试卸载并重新执行“idear下载”和安装步骤。

总结:开启您的“idear”编程之旅

通过本文的详细指导,您应该已经掌握了“idear下载”的官方途径、版本选择、详细安装步骤以及初次配置和常见故障排除方法。IntelliJ IDEA作为一款业界领先的IDE,将极大地提升您的开发效率和体验。

从精确的“idear下载”到细致的安装配置,每一步都至关重要。现在,您已准备好利用这款强大的工具,深入探索Java、Kotlin以及更广阔的编程世界。祝您编程愉快,高效产出!

常见问题解答(FAQ)

Q1: 如何区分IntelliJ IDEA Community版和Ultimate版?
A1: Community版是免费开源的,主要用于Java、Kotlin、Android应用及Maven/Gradle项目开发,功能核心且强大。Ultimate版是付费的,在社区版基础上,提供更全面的企业级框架(如Spring、Java EE)、Web开发(HTML/CSS/JS/TS/React/Angular/Vue)、数据库工具、高级版本控制和服务器部署支持。
Q2: 为何我的“idear”下载速度很慢?
A2: 下载速度慢可能由多种原因导致,包括您的网络带宽限制、JetBrains服务器当时的负载较高、或您所在地区与服务器之间的网络延迟。您可以尝试使用专业的下载管理器、更换网络环境,或在非网络高峰期进行下载。
Q3: “idear”下载后无法安装,可能是什么原因?
A3: 无法安装通常是由于系统不满足最低要求(如内存、磁盘空间不足)、下载的安装包损坏、操作系统权限问题(未以管理员身份运行)、或被防病毒软件误拦截。建议您检查系统配置、重新下载并校验安装包,并尝试关闭安全软件后再次安装。
Q4: IntelliJ IDEA需要付费吗?
A4: IntelliJ IDEA的Community(社区)版本是完全免费的,功能足以满足大多数个人和教育目的的开发需求。而Ultimate(旗舰)版本是付费的商业软件,但提供30天免费试用期,且学生和教师可以通过教育授权免费使用。
Q5: 如何确保下载的“idear”是安全的?
A5: 确保“idear下载”安全的最重要方法是只从JetBrains官方网站下载https://www.jetbrains.com/idea/download/)。官方网站提供的安装包是经过数字签名且无病毒的。下载完成后,您可以进一步核对官方提供的MD5或SHA-256校验值,确保下载文件的完整性。
idear下载